Oued es Sebkra
Oued es Sebkra is a wadi in Tozeur Governorate, Tunisia. Oued es Sebkra is situated nearby to the locality El Erg, as well as near El-Hamma-Djerid.Places in the Area

Degache, also spelled Degueche, is a Tunisian town and commune situated in the region of Djerid, and part of Tozeur Governorate. It had a population of 14,332 in 2014, and is the biggest town of a delegation bearing its name. Degache is situated 9 km southeast of Oued es Sebkra.
